Marie Dorothy Marceau 1946 - 2007

Marie Dorothy Marceau of Laconia, Belknap County, NH was born on November 8, 1946, and died at age 60 years old on March 15, 2007. Marie Marceau was buried at New Hampshire State Cemetery Section 6 Row O Site 367 110 Daniel Webster Highway (rt3), in Boscawen.
